Comparing 8 Best Wearable Trackers for Dogs

Tracker NameKey FeatureBattery LifeConnectivityHealth/ActivityGeo-FenceSubscriptionBest For
Fi Smart Dog CollarDurability, ActivityUp to 90 daysLTE-M, GPSYesYesYesActive dogs, big breeds
Tractive GPS TrackerFast Real-Time2-6 daysLTE, GPSYesYesYesTravelers, explorers
PetPace 2.0Medical Health7+ daysCellular, BluetoothYesNoYesOlder/chronic pets
Halo CollarTraining, Wireless FenceUp to 20 daysLTE, GPSYesYesYesYard boundaries, training
Whistle Go Explore 2.0Advanced WellnessUp to 17 daysLTE-M, GPSYesYesYesData-focused owners
Apple AirTagAffordable Tracking12 monthsBluetoothNoNoNoUrban, simple tracking
Garmin Alpha T 20Rural Precision2.8 daysIridium satelliteYesNoYesLong-distance, hunting
PitPat Activity MonitorSimple FitnessUp to 6 monthsBluetoothYesNoNoEasy, affordable tracking

What Must-Know Features Should You Look For?

1. Real-time Tracking

GPS/LTE will provide real-time high-precision updates that become essential in response time in both the city and the country. 

2. Geo-Fencing and Escape Alerts

Digital fences inform the proprietors whenever pets move out of their targeted areas, limiting the losses. 

3. Health and Monitoring of Activities

Record the number of steps, sleep, eating, and scratching, and proactively alert the veterinarian to issues related to their health early.

4. Application Compatibility

Top dog wearable trackers are connected to powerful apps, which provide data visualization and remote alerts as well as shared logs about the pet being looked after. 

5. Battery Life

The buyer should consider the balance between the battery requirements and battery usage; long-lasting cells or quick-charge batteries are beneficial to busy owners or frequent travelers. 

6. Durability and Fitting On 

Trackers must not be too small and must be waterproof and can be played with without becoming loose or snagged on the roughness of the canine; they should fit the dog as well as his size and his neckline allows. 

7. Subscription Plans

There are also subscription plans with certain trackers, which demand continuous payment of fees for data plans, health reports, or additional features. Before buying, it is better to revisit them.
